We the People ask President Barack Obama to continue his environmental promise and end the practice of Mountain Top Removal (MTR). We ask this for the following reasons:
-MTR releases toxic chemicals into our rivers and destroys our national heritage. The practice of MTR is hazardous to public health.
- MRT damages communities by polarizing citizens against each other.
-MTR damages regional employment. West Virginia has lost over 100,000 mining jobs since 1948, yet coal extraction has risen.
Coal River Mountain in West Virginia is currently planned for MTR, even though it has significant wind power potential. By prohibiting MTR and encouraging wind power it would set a precedent for the rest of the region. We ask to use this opportunity as a turning point for clean domestic energy.
